What is Deviled Ham Spread?

Deviled Ham Spread is a savory sandwich spread made from cooked ham, spices, mustard, and mayonnaise. It has a smooth texture and a slightly spicy flavor that mixes well with bread, crackers, or vegetables. It's a popular choice for a quick lunch or snack because it's easy to use and doesn't require much preparation. The origin of Deviled Ham Spread can be traced back to the early 1900s, when it became a popular food product in America. It was created as a way to use up leftover ham and other ingredients, and it quickly became a staple in households across the country.

What are the ingredients in Deviled Ham Spread?

Deviled Ham Spread is typically made from cooked ham, spices, mustard, and mayonnaise. Some variations may also include other ingredients, such as onion powder, garlic powder, or paprika. The exact recipe can vary depending on the brand or personal preference, but most recipes include these basic ingredients. How many calories are in 1/4 cup of Deviled Ham Spread?

One serving of Deviled Ham Spread, which is typically 1/4 cup (60 g), contains about 180 calories. This can vary slightly depending on the brand and specific recipe used. It's important to keep in mind that this calorie count applies only to the Deviled Ham Spread itself and does not include any bread or other items it may be paired with. Nutritional Values of 1/4 cup (60 g) Deviled Ham Spread

UnitValue
Calories (kcal)180 kcal
Fat (g)15 g
Carbs (g)1 g
Protein (g)8 g

Calorie breakdown: 79% fat, 2% carbs, 19% protein
